Bahrain strips top Shi'ite Muslim cleric of citizenship -agency

By Sami Aboudi
DUBAI, Jun 20 (Reuters) Bahrain has stripped the spiritual leader of the Gulf kingdom's Shi'ite Muslim majority of his citizenship, state news agency BNA reported today, prompting protests by thousands outside his home and warnings of unrest.
The move against Ayatollah Isa Qassim comes less than a week after a court ordered Bahrain's main opposition al-Wefaq group closed, accusing it of fomenting sectarian unrest and of having links to a foreign power - an apparent reference to regional Shi'ite power Iran.
